Why Mouse Infestations Are So Common in Northern Virginia

Northern Virginia’s suburban landscape provides ideal conditions for house mouse and deer mouse populations to thrive. Wooded lots and stream corridors provide outdoor habitat. Residential neighborhoods provide abundant food sources — bird feeders, outdoor grills, pet food left outside, gardens and compost bins — and the warm structure of homes provides exactly the winter shelter mice are seeking.

Mouse populations can be very large in Northern Virginia neighborhoods, and the pressure on homes from surrounding populations means that even after an infestation is eliminated, new mice will attempt to enter unless entry points are physically sealed. This is why professional mice exterminator service — which combines elimination of the current infestation with exclusion to prevent reinfestation — is far more effective than simply setting snap traps and hoping for the best.

How Fast a Mouse Problem Grows

One of the most important reasons to call a professional mice exterminator promptly rather than waiting to see if the problem resolves itself is the extraordinary reproductive rate of mice. A female house mouse produces five to ten litters per year with five to six pups per litter. The young mice reach reproductive maturity in as little as six weeks. A small initial invasion in October can become a very large, established infestation by December if not addressed immediately.

The damage accumulates in parallel with the population. Electrical wiring chewed by mice is a documented fire hazard. Insulation contaminated by mouse droppings and urine needs costly replacement. Food stores in pantries and cabinets are contaminated. The faster you act — and the more comprehensively you act, with a professional mice exterminator rather than a hardware store trap — the less damage the infestation ultimately causes.

Why Store-Bought Mouse Traps Are Not Enough

Store-bought snap traps and basic bait stations can catch individual mice, but they do not address the three fundamentals of a successful mice exterminator program: finding and sealing the entry points mice are using to access your home, placing bait stations and traps in the optimal locations based on a professional assessment of mouse activity patterns throughout the structure, and implementing a monitoring program to confirm that the infestation has been fully eliminated.

The result of relying on hardware store traps is typically a frustrating cycle of catching a few mice, thinking the problem is solved, and then finding new evidence of activity a week later — because new mice are continuously entering through unsealed entry points and replenishing the population inside the home. Professional mice exterminator service breaks this cycle by addressing all three fundamentals simultaneously.

How do mice get into Northern Virginia homes?

Mice can enter through openings as small as a dime — approximately a quarter inch in diameter. The most common entry points in Northern Virginia homes include gaps around pipe and utility penetrations in the foundation and exterior walls, gaps under garage doors and entry doors with worn weather stripping, cracks in the foundation, unscreened vents and weep holes, gaps where siding meets the foundation or roofline, and openings around chimney and fireplace flashings. Professional inspection identifies all of these entry points systematically, which is far more effective than homeowners attempting to find them on their own.

How long does it take to eliminate a mouse infestation with professional service?

Most Northern Virginia homeowners see a significant reduction in mouse activity within one to two weeks of professional service initiation. Complete elimination of an established infestation typically takes two to four weeks, depending on population size and the number of entry points through which mice continue to enter from outside. Follow-up monitoring visits are essential to confirm that the infestation has been fully resolved. Exclusion work — sealing entry points — is the key to preventing reinfestation after the active population is eliminated.
